[QUOTE="Munyaradzi Mafaro, post: 76439, member: 636"] Road crews are clearing a landslide that blocked the Troyan Pass near Karnare village on the II-35 highway connecting Troyan with the area. Five machines are working the site at the 117-kilometer mark after heavy rain dumped enough water to send rocks and dirt sliding onto the road. Workers from the Regional Road Administration in Plovdiv showed up to help speed things along. The Road Infrastructure Agency said drivers can check conditions on their website or call a hotline while the pass stays closed. Officials want people to chill out on risky passing moves once traffic opens back up. [/QUOTE]
